Now that thousands of trash carts in Moline have new lids, it's time to put something on them. This week, National Cart Marketing is placing advertising on the special lids that were installed last month.
Company president, Phil Bonello, says the first ads are for health care, plumbing supplies, and foundation repairs, plus a pizza give-away.
And part of the lid is reserved for messages and information from the city.

Bonello says his company has placed similar trash lids with advertising in five cities in Indiana, and is in the process of setting up programs in 3 cities in Michigan.
As he says, "it's like direct mail, without the mail."
Last year, Moline and National Cart Marketing set up a pilot program in several neighborhoods, and based on its success, are making it city-wide this year. The one change is a different, and much lower profile, lid that's also much lighter.
